Bacteria and archaea are susceptible to viral infections just like eukaryotes; therefore, they have developed a unique adaptive immune system to protect themselves. Clustered regularly interspaced short palindromic repeats and CRISPR-associated proteins (CRISPR-Cas) are present in more than 45% of known bacteria and 90% of known archaea.

The basic reaction of homologous recombination (HR) involves two chromatids that contain DNA sequences sharing a significant stretch of identity. One of these sequences uses a strand from another as a template to synthesize DNA in an enzyme-catalyzed reaction. The final product is a novel amalgamation of the two substrates. Because the DNA segments are cut and reorganized in a direction-specific manner, site-specific recombination has emerged as an efficient genetic engineering technique. Flippase and Cyclization recombinases or Flp and Cre, respectively, are two members of the tyrosine recombinase family derived from bacteriophages, that are used to mediate site-specific DNA insertions, deletions, and targeted expression of proteins in mammalian cell lines.

通过结构切换V型分裂探头实现多功能CRISPR/Cas12a自催化级联系统,用于高度敏感的DNA诊断.

Zhun Lin1, Zhe Pu1, Jiacheng Wu1

  • 1State Key Laboratory of Anti-Infective Drug Discovery and Development; School of Pharmaceutical Sciences, Sun Yat-sen University, Guangzhou 510006, China.

Analytical chemistry
|December 15, 2025
PubMed
概括

这项研究引入了一种新的,无放大CRISPR/Cas诊断系统,用于快速检测病原体核酸. 它实现了对关节的敏感性,为传染病诊断提供了更简单,更快的替代方案.

科学领域:

  • 分子生物学分子生物学
  • 生物技术是生物技术.
  • 传染病诊断 传染病诊断 传染病诊断

背景情况:

  • 准确和快速检测病原体核酸对于管理传染病至关重要.
  • 目前的分子诊断,包括CRISPR/Cas系统,通常需要预放大,导致复杂的工作流程和昂贵的设备.

研究的目的:

  • 开发一种基于CRISPR/Cas的快速,简单和无放大诊断系统.
  • 为了提高敏感性和减少病原体检测方法的复杂性.

主要方法:

  • 使用一个结构切换的V形DNA探头与一个分裂的Cas12a识别序列.
  • 实现了正反循环和信号放大级联,用于指数信号生成.
  • 将系统集成到微流体和侧流量测试中.

主要成果:

  • 实现了超低的背景信号与快速,指数级的信号产生.
  • 对于病原体DNA检测,已显示出多敏度.
  • 成功应用于人类乳头瘤病毒菌株的多重检测和麻疹病毒的临床检测.

结论:

  • 开发的无放大CRISPR/Cas系统在快速和敏感的病原体DNA检测方面取得了重大进展.
  • 这种方法对临床实验室和临床诊断应用都有很大的潜力.
  • 简化工作流程,减少对昂贵设备的依赖,以诊断传染病.
